Online piano lessons are a simple and cost-effective method for students to learn to play the piano from at the ease of own home. The lessons can be conducted via video conferencing services like Zoom, Skype, or Google Meet, and can be scheduled at a time and place that is convenient for the student.
One of the biggest advantages for online lessons in piano is the versatility that they offer. Students can attend lessons at a time that is convenient for them, and they are able to stop or rewind their lesson at any time. This allows them to study at their own pace, and is not necessary to hurry through a lesson or lose important details.
Another benefit that online lessons offer is the ability to connect with a wider variety of instructors. Physical location is no longer a barrier to finding a professional piano instructor. It is possible for students to find a teacher that is specialized in the kind of music they are looking for, or a teacher who has worked with students of their skill level.
Online piano lessons also provide an opportunity for students to get feedback on their performances in real-time. This makes for an interactive and enjoyable learning experience. It also lets the instructor provide immediate feedback and instruction.
In terms of the equipment required, all that is required to take classes online is piano keyboard and a laptop or computer with a webcam, and a reliable internet connection. Some teachers might also recommend using a metronome, which assists students in keeping precise time while playing.
Although online piano lessons may offer a convenient and efficient method to learn perform on the piano, these lessons may not be suitable for everyone. For example, young children might struggle to stay engaged in a video class and could benefit more from lessons in person. Furthermore, certain students might prefer the interaction aspect of lessons in person and find online lessons less motivating.
